How they compare

Colombia currently reports 0.1 deaths per 100,000 people against 0.07 deaths per 100,000 people in South Sudan, a difference of 0.03 deaths per 100,000 people.

That makes Colombia's figure about 1.4 times South Sudan's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 22 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Colombia ahead.

Colombia ranks 32nd and South Sudan ranks 35th of 194 countries.

Colombia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Colombia South Sudan Difference Ahead
2000s 0.362 deaths per 100,000 people 0.019 deaths per 100,000 people 0.343 deaths per 100,000 people Colombia
2010s 0.572 deaths per 100,000 people 0.149 deaths per 100,000 people 0.423 deaths per 100,000 people Colombia
2020s 0.11 deaths per 100,000 people 0.035 deaths per 100,000 people 0.075 deaths per 100,000 people Colombia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
